The Schneider PCR 101 functions as a precision control relay module designed for applications requiring accurate and reliable switching performance. This unit provides isolated contact outputs for interfacing control logic with field devices such as contactors, solenoid valves, and indicator lights. You can depend on this module for consistent operation in industrial automation systems.

Precision Relay Configuration

The PCR 101 features 4 independent SPDT relay outputs, each providing both normally open and normally closed contacts. This flexibility allows you to control diverse loads with a single module. You can therefore simplify wiring and reduce component count in your control panels.

Each channel includes a dedicated LED indicator that illuminates when the coil energizes. This visual feedback proves invaluable during commissioning and troubleshooting. Technicians can quickly verify output states without additional test equipment.

Robust Contact Ratings

We equipped the Schneider PCR 101 with heavy-duty contacts rated at 5 A at 250 VAC and 5 A at 30 VDC. This capacity handles most pilot-duty applications directly without intermediate relays. Common loads include motor contactors, solenoid valves, and panel indication lights.

The relay contacts achieve 10 million mechanical operations and 100,000 electrical operations at full load. This longevity ensures years of reliable service in typical industrial applications. You benefit from reduced maintenance intervals and lower lifecycle costs.

Electrical Isolation and Protection

Industrial control systems require isolation between logic circuits and field wiring. The PCR 101 provides 2000 V RMS isolation between coil and contacts, protecting sensitive PLC outputs from voltage transients. This isolation also prevents ground loops that could compromise signal integrity.

The module draws only 0.5 W per channel from the 24 VDC control supply, placing minimal load on system power sources. Low power consumption proves particularly valuable in densely populated panels with limited power budgets.

Physical Design and Installation

Measuring 90 mm x 70 mm x 60 mm and weighing 0.3 kg, the PCR 101 occupies minimal panel space. The compact form factor allows dense mounting alongside other control components. You can mount the module on DIN rail or directly on a panel using the integrated mounting tabs.

Captive clamp screw terminals accept 0.2 mm² to 4 mm² wiring, accommodating most industrial control cables. The terminals feature clear numbering for error-free connections. You can terminate wires quickly without special tools.

Application Versatility

The Schneider PCR 101 suits diverse applications across manufacturing, process control, and building automation. Typical uses include interposing relay functions, load switching, signal isolation, and small motor control. The SPDT contact configuration provides maximum wiring flexibility.

Environmental Durability

This precision relay module operates reliably in -20°C to +55°C environments, suitable for most industrial facilities. The -40°C to +85°C storage range allows safe transport and inventory stocking. CE, UL, and CSA approvals ensure compliance with global standards for industrial equipment.
